Micro Retreats for the Burned-Out Professional: A Rejuvenating Escape in Bite-Sized Breaks
Burnout has turn out to be a defining struggle for right now’s professional. With relentless schedules, fixed digital connectivity, and ever-rising expectations, many workers find themselves emotionally drained and physically exhausted. However taking a long trip is usually not feasible. Enter the micro retreat—a compact, highly effective answer for restoring balance and mental clarity.
What Is a Micro Retreat?
A micro retreat is a short, intentional getaway that typically lasts between a number of hours to 2 days. Unlike traditional holidays that may span a week or more, micro retreats give attention to quick restoration. These mini-breaks are often held in nature-centric settings, quiet boutique spaces, or wellness hubs, and are designed to offer deep leisure without requiring extended time off.
Why Burned-Out Professionals Want Micro Retreats
The chronic stress associated with high-performance jobs typically leads to fatigue, reduced productivity, and even health issues. Micro retreats give professionals an opportunity to hit the reset button. Whether it’s through mindfulness, yoga, digital detoxing, or simply resting in silence, these temporary escapes can significantly reduce stress and assist restore emotional equilibrium.
They also provide an environment the place you’re not required to "do" anything. The pressure to be productive disappears, allowing the mind to rest and the body to recover. For many professionals, this easy act of disengaging—even for a short time—can be transformative.
Key Elements of an Effective Micro Retreat
To maximize their impact, micro retreats are often built round a number of core components:
Nature Immersion: Being in natural surroundings—even for just a couple of hours—has a calming impact on the nervous system. Forest trails, beach walks, or countryside lodges provide grounding experiences that urban environments simply can’t match.
Mindfulness Practices: Many micro retreats incorporate meditation, breathwork, or journaling. These methods assist center the mind, making space for introspection and emotional release.
Digital Detox: A typical element in many retreats is a no-gadget policy. Disconnecting from phones and screens permits participants to be totally current and reduce the cognitive overload tied to constant notifications.
Creative Expression: Activities like painting, writing, or even cooking allow for emotional expression and might reignite a sense of purpose or joy.
Professional Steering: Some micro retreats are hosted by wellness coaches, therapists, or yoga instructors who guide participants through structured sessions. This presents added support for those who need help navigating burnout recovery.
Where to Find Micro Retreats
As demand grows, micro retreats are becoming more accessible. City wellness centers, countryside resorts, and even Airbnb hosts are actually providing customizable packages that cater to professionals needing a quick reset. Major cities often have same-day options or overnight retreats within a brief drive. You can too find specialised programs targeting executives, tech workers, healthcare professionals, and entrepreneurs.
Platforms like Retreat Guru or Hipcamp might help you discover suitable options, and lots of professionals at the moment are even organizing DIY retreats at close by cabins or nature parks.
Ideas for Planning Your Own Micro Retreat
When you’re brief on time or budget, you may plan a personalized micro retreat. Choose a location within one or hours of travel. Limit outside communication, prepare nourishing meals, and produce materials for relaxation akin to a journal, yoga mat, or a good book. Set clear intentions—whether it's to rest, replicate, or reset—and honor that commitment throughout your time away.
Even a full day of silence, nature, and reflection can dramatically reduce burnout symptoms.
The Takeaway
Micro retreats provide a practical, accessible answer for professionals who're feeling overwhelmed. They don’t require a major financial investment or long day without work, but they deliver highly effective mental and emotional benefits. Whether or not guided or self-directed, these compact getaways can be the key to recovering balance, boosting creativity, and sustaining long-term productivity in the demanding world of modern work.
